Recovering your nervous system does not happen overnight. It's a steady process of aiding your body really feel safe againphysically, emotionally and emotionally. Right here are seven functional means to start. Deep, slow-moving breathing is among the quickest ways to calm a dysregulated nervous system. Try this straightforward method: breathe in gradually with your nose for four matters, hold for 4 counts, exhale via your mouth for six counts and pause for two matters previously duplicating.
Also a few minutes of deep breathing a day can make a difference. If you're uncertain exactly how to obtain begun, there are mobile phone applications offered that guide you through brief reflection practices. When you're stressed out, your body launches adrenaline and cortisol. Activity assists melt off those anxiety hormonal agents and recover equilibrium.
Stay clear of consuming after you go to bed. Stay clear of snoozing throughout the day. Switch off screens a minimum of an hour before bed. Maintain your area cool and dark. Journal or pay attention to soothing noises prior to bed. Gradually, a predictable regular aids signal to your body that it's time to transform off your brain and remainder.
Avoiding meals or depending on caffeine and sugar can make anxious system dysregulation even worse. Objective for routine, balanced meals with healthy protein, healthy fats and complicated carbohydrates. Foods abundant in magnesium (like leafy greens and nuts) and omega-3s (like salmon and flaxseed) can likewise sustain brain health. Stress is your body's feedback to adjustments that need attention or action. Chronic tension can negatively impact your wellness and cause mental illness. Workout and self-care are effective tools for handling and lowering tension levels. Stress and anxiety can be defined as any kind of sort of adjustment that causes physical, emotional, or mental pressure.
Every person experiences stress to some degree. The method you respond to anxiety, nevertheless, makes a large difference to your total mental and physical wellness.
Not all kinds of stress and anxiety are unsafe and even unfavorable. Some of the various types of anxiety that you might experience include:: Intense tension is an extremely temporary type of stress that can be disturbing or stressful; this is the kind of anxiety that runs out the average, such as an auto crash, attack, or natural disaster.
When the viewed risk is gone, systems are developed to go back to normal feature through the leisure reaction. Yet in situations of chronic stress, the relaxation feedback doesn't take place often enough, and being in a near-constant state of fight-or-flight can cause damages to the body. Stress can likewise cause some harmful habits that have a negative influence on your health and wellness.
Tension can have a number of effects on your health and wellness and wellness. The link between your mind and body is noticeable when you take a look at tension's effect on your life.
The inverse is likewise true. Illness, whether you're taking care of hypertension or diabetes mellitus, will certainly also impact your stress level and psychological wellness. When your brain experiences high levels of tension, your body reacts appropriately. Serious acute anxiety, like being involved in an all-natural disaster or entering into a spoken run-in, can trigger heart strikes, arrhythmias, and also premature death.
Anxiety also takes a psychological toll. While some anxiety may produce feelings of light stress and anxiety or stress, long term tension can likewise bring about fatigue, anxiety problems, and clinical depression. Chronic stress can have a significant influence on your health. If you experience persistent stress, your autonomic nerve system will be overactive, which is likely to harm your body.
